Coach Gary Phillips, who made several changes from the team which lost to Dagenham & Redbridge, suffered a nightmare on the bench as his side folded against Division Three Braintree Town in the Guardian Insurance Cup First Round. Braintree played far better than one would expect of a Division Three side, but that doesn't alter the fact that United's fans deserved far better from their own side. Indeed, by half-time Braintree had killed off the tie with three goals in the first half. Simpson opened the scoring after seventeen minutes, scored his second after thirty-four minutes, and a minute later Falana made it three. Kevin Davies pulled a goal back on thirty-nine minutes to give United a ray of hope to make it 1-3. But matters failed to improve in the second half, not helped when Devereaux scored after fifty-two minutes to put the result beyond doubt. After this embarassing defeat Phillips released winger Robert Boyce and defender Danny Honeyball. |
